ELIGIBILITY PROVISIONS: INSURANCE FOR YOU ELIGIBLE FOR PEBB BENEFITS All Actively at Work employees of an Employing Agency, except for employees of an Employer Group that do not contract with the Policyholder for the insurance benefits described in this certificate. Totally Disabled Patrolmen, Disability Leave Patrolmen and Disability Status Patrolmen deemed disabled in the line of duty by the Chief of Washington State Patrol (WSP); Actively at Work requirements do not apply to Totally Disabled Patrolmen, Disability Leave Patrolmen and Disability Status Patrolmen. DATE YOU ARE ELIGIBLE FOR INSURANCE You may only become eligible for the insurance available for Your eligible class as shown in the SCHEDULE OF BENEFITS. If You are eligible for PEBB benefits on January 1, 2024, You will be eligible for the insurance described in this certificate on that date. If You become eligible for PEBB benefits after January 1, 2024, You will be eligible for the insurance described in this certificate on the date You become eligible for PEBB benefits. Previous Employment With The Employing Agency If You were employed by an Employing Agency and insured by Us under a policy of group life insurance when Your employment ended, You will not be eligible for life insurance under this Group Policy if You are re-hired by the Employing Agency within 2 years after such employment ended, unless You surrender:  any individual policy of life insurance to which You converted when Your employment ended; and  any certificate of insurance continued as ported insurance when such employment ended. The cash value, if any, of such surrendered insurance will be paid to You. ENROLLMENT PROCESS You are automatically enrolled for Employer-Paid Insurance if You become eligible for PEBB benefits. If You are eligible for Employee-Paid Life Insurance, You may enroll by completing the required form. In addition, You must give evidence of Your Insurability satisfactory to Us at Your expense if You are required to do so under the section entitled EVIDENCE OF INSURABILITY. DATE YOUR INSURANCE TAKES EFFECT Requirements for Employer-Paid Insurance: Basic Life Insurance and Basic Accidental Death and Dismemberment Insurance Employer-Paid Insurance will take effect on the first day of the month following the date You become eligible for PEBB benefits. If You become eligible for PEBB benefits on the first working day of the month, Employer- Paid Insurance will take effect on that date. Employer-Paid Insurance for Faculty hired on a quarter/semester to quarter/semester basis will take effect the first day of the month following the beginning of the second consecutive quarter/semester of half-time or more employment. If the first day of the second consecutive quarter/semester is the first working day of the month, Employer-Paid Insurance will take effect at the beginning of the second consecutive quarter/semester.
